    When I'm connected to the internet, every so often a little warning pops up asking if I want to stay connected. What i want is to turn off this warning. Any suggestions?
    Thanks

    Kappy-thank you; and for your info,
    Open the Network pane of System Preferences.
    NOTE: in lower left is a security lock that you may need to UNLOCK as you enter and LOCK as you leave.
    If you are using a phone line, choose Internal Modem from the Show: menu, and then click PPP Tab, click on PPP Options, get a window full of Session Options AND Advanced Options. Check or Uncheck what you need to, click OK, click Apply Now.
    If you are using Ethernet (DSL), choose Built-in Ethernet from the Show: menu, and then choose PPPoE, (2nd tab from left in the list of connections), click the PPPoE Options button, get a window of Session Options AND Advanced Options. The second check box of Session Options is our PAIN and you may want to consider the 3rd check box before you exit.

    This procedure may show which program is using the camera. It makes no changes, and therefore will not, in itself, solve your problem.
    If you have more than one user account, you must be logged in as an administrator to carry out these instructions.
    Please triple-click anywhere in the line below on this page to select it:
    sudo lsof -Fc +D /L*/Cor*/*/*/AppleCamera.plugin | sed '2!d' | cut -c2- | pbcopy
    Copy the selected text to the Clipboard by pressing the key combination command-C.
    Launch the built-in Terminal application in any of the following ways:
    ☞ Enter the first few letters of its name into a Spotlight search. Select it in the results (it should be at the top.)
    ☞ In the Finder, select Go ▹ Utilities from the menu bar, or press the key combination shift-command-U. The application is in the folder that opens.
    ☞ Open LaunchPad. Click Utilities, then Terminal in the icon grid.
    Paste into the Terminal window by pressing the key combination command-V. I've tested these instructions only with the Safari web browser. If you use another browser, you may have to press the return key after pasting. You'll be prompted for your login password. Nothing will be displayed when you type it. If you don’t have a login password, you’ll need to set one before you can run the command. You may get a one-time warning to be careful. Confirm. You don't need to post the warning.
    If you see a message that your username "is not in the sudoers file," then you're not logged in as an administrator. Log in as one and start over.
    Wait for a new line ending in a dollar sign ($) to appear below what you entered.
    The output of the command will be automatically copied to the Clipboard. If the command produced no output, the Clipboard will be empty. Paste into a reply to this message.
    The Terminal window doesn't show the output. Please don't copy anything from there.

  • My iPod Classic 160 is in disc mode and won't turn off, itunes doesn't recognize it - ¿how can I make it work again?

    My iPod Classic 160 is in disc mode.  I responds to nothing.  iTunes doesn't recognize it.  It doesn't sync.  I've tried to restore and got error 1429.  Now it just stays in disc mode and won't turn off.  I'm keeping it connected to the charger so it doesn't go dead.  Is there anything I can do to resurrect my pod?

    To get out of disk mode do a iPod Hard Reset.
    Toggle the Hold switch till you dont see the red mark.
    Press Menu and Center buttons simultaneously for about 10 secs till the Apple logo comes ON then release the buttons
    Select your preferred language.
